This ledger supports narrow claims with dated evidence. It does not claim to be the “most authoritative.” Authority is earned through reproducible breadth, freshness, corrections, independent use, and citations.

Claim status

  • VERIFIED — the cited evidence directly supports the claim within its stated scope.
  • PROVISIONAL — evidence exists but requires another vantage, a longer window, or public reproduction.
  • UNKNOWN — the required observation has not been completed.
  • RETRACTED — the claim was wrong; the correction and reason remain visible.
  • SUPERSEDED — a later claim or method replaces it.

Evidence entries

fleet-denominator-2026-08-13

  • Claim: One bounded external fleet run checked all 221 selected domains and recorded an honest denominator and aggregate classifications.
  • Status: VERIFIED
  • Scope: 220 private-roster domains plus one external control; one observation window.
  • Evidence tier: E2 — multiple identities/canary with source and roster hashes in the private immutable receipt.
  • Result: 197 OK, 0 infected, 2 suspect, 2 down, 0 blocked, 20 unreachable.
  • Public artifact: examples/receipts/fleet-aggregate-2026-08-13.json
  • Redaction: property identities, domain-level findings, paths, and raw responses withheld.
  • Limitation: this was a bounded public guard, not the full field-hardened internal monitor, and it did not inspect authenticated layers.
  • Next action: publish a stable probe interface and make the current tested internal engine implement it.

detector-false-positive-correction-2026-07-21

  • Claim: A security detector’s false positives were converted into boundary-aware parsing, positive and negative regression fixtures, and a larger test suite.
  • Status: VERIFIED
  • Scope: one monitor family and its dated correction history.
  • Evidence tier: E3 — source, append-only run log, and 116 local assertions reviewed in the authoring workspace.
  • Public artifact: examples/case-studies/02-monitor-false-positive.md
  • Limitation: private site identities, authenticated configuration, and baseline contents are not distributed.
  • Next action: publish the sanitized detector fixture and generated test receipt in a later release.

unknown-is-not-clean-2026-08-10

  • Claim: A corrected access audit separated unresearched/blocked observations from verified failures instead of scoring missing evidence as clean.
  • Status: VERIFIED
  • Scope: 285 properties in a dated internal audit; 21 remained explicit unknowns.
  • Evidence tier: E3 — authenticated aggregate audit plus regression tests.
  • Public artifact: examples/case-studies/03-unknown-not-clean.md
  • Limitation: property rows, credential coverage, account identifiers, and client names remain private.
  • Next action: publish a fully synthetic audit fixture that proves the state partition and residual assertion.

skills-need-citable-pages-2026-08-02

  • Claim: Twenty-four skill files and ZIP entries were not independently citable until the publishing system generated one provenance-bearing implementation page per skill and extended the runner and verifier to keep the page tier current.
  • Status: VERIFIED
  • Scope: the skill-pack publication system at the dated release.
  • Evidence tier: E3 — generator, runner contract, verifier, and learning record reviewed.
  • Public artifact: examples/case-studies/04-skills-need-pages.md
  • Limitation: later page availability must be reverified separately; historical generation is not proof of current reachability.
  • Next action: give every Web Function skill a clearly classified implementation page and verify task ↔ hub ↔ skill ↔ page ↔ release consistency.

Required fields for future entries

Every new entry records: stable evidence ID; narrow claim; status; subjects and denominator; observation window; observed and reverified dates; evidence tier; collector and version/hash; positive and negative controls; metrics; limitations; public, sanitized, and private artifact references; independent reproduction; redaction class; related incident, run, skills, and job; owner; next action; and supersession link.
